Now to cut and assembling the front porch.

The front porch and railing will support the roof overhang and also keep adults from walking off the side of the front porch, remember, the side of the front porch roof is only five feet high... remember that!!!

This is a lot of work but it really makes the playhouse.

I decided later on that I would apply slats to the two outside edges of each 2x4 post because I didn't like the looks of the generic 2x4 posts. I think it looks a little chunky now but better than before.
